Topical Steroid

A Topical Steroid (pronunciation: /ˈtɒpɪkəl ˈstɪərɔɪd/) is a type of Steroid medication that is applied directly to the skin to reduce inflammation and irritation.

Etymology

The term "Topical" is derived from the Greek word "topikos," which means "of a place," and "Steroid" is derived from the Greek word "stereos," which means "solid." The term "Topical Steroid" was first used in the medical field in the mid-20th century.

Usage

Topical Steroids are used to treat a variety of skin conditions, including Eczema, Psoriasis, and Dermatitis. They are available in various forms, such as creams, ointments, and lotions. The strength of the steroid varies depending on the specific medication and the condition it is being used to treat.

Related Terms

  • Corticosteroid: A type of steroid hormone that reduces inflammation in the body.
  • Hydrocortisone: A mild topical steroid often used to treat skin conditions.
  • Betamethasone: A potent topical steroid used to treat severe skin conditions.
  • Topical medication: A medication that is applied to body surfaces such as the skin or mucous membranes.

Side Effects

Like all medications, Topical Steroids can have side effects. These may include skin thinning, changes in skin color, and irritation at the application site. Long-term use of high-strength steroids can also lead to systemic side effects such as high blood pressure and bone thinning.

Precautions

Topical Steroids should be used under the guidance of a healthcare professional. They should be used for the shortest possible time and in the smallest amount that effectively treats the condition.
